gpt4 book ai didi

google-maps - 使用 javascript 加载多个 map 库

转载 作者:行者123 更新时间:2023-12-02 20:29:27 29 4
gpt4 key购买 nike

我正在尝试使用 javascript 加载 map 库和地点库,以便我可以将 map 嵌入到我的页面中,使用 google.maps.geometry.spherical 函数并发出地点搜索请求,但我无法加载所有内容3 个图书馆。目前我正在导入:

<script type="text/javascript"src="http://maps.google.com/maps?key=mykey"></script>
<script type="text/javascript"src="http://maps.googleapis.com/maps/api/js?sensor=false&libraries=places"></script>

但我收到错误:

syntax error
[Break On This Error]

...gs4d .gbmac,.gbes#gbg4 #gbgs4d .gbmac{margin:34px 0 0}.gbemi#gb #gbgs4d .gbmac,....

maps?k...hrkDAmw (line 1)

GClientGeocoder is not defined
[Break On This Error]

var geocoder = new GClientGeocoder();

我哪里出错了?

非常感谢。

最佳答案

第一个脚本不指向 JavaScript,这将尝试加载 maps-homepage作为脚本(当然这会失败)。

不需要包含多个脚本,只需使用:

<script type="text/javascript"
src="http://maps.googleapis.com/maps/api/js?libraries=geometry,places&sensor=false">

这将加载 map API(V3) 并包括地点+几何库

https://developers.google.com/maps/documentation/javascript/libraries?hl=en

但是,正如 Colin 所说,这看起来像是 V2 代码。

关于google-maps - 使用 javascript 加载多个 map 库,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9786272/

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com